Best Photo Locations at Waldorf Astoria Monarch Beach
The Oceanfront Ceremony Lawn — panoramic coastal views and soft natural light
Palm-Lined Walkways — clean lines and classic Southern California scenery
The Terrace Areas — elegant backdrops for portraits and cocktail hour
Resort Grounds & Gardens — greenery, symmetry, and flattering light
Sunset Viewpoints — golden-hour portraits overlooking the Pacific

Best Time for Photos at Waldorf Astoria Monarch Beach
The most flattering light happens during the final 60–90 minutes before sunset. This is when the ocean softens, the grounds glow, and the venue feels calm and romantic. I help build timelines that make the most of this window while keeping the day stress-free.
